A lot of my complaining had to do with the shortsightedness of using these characters in these molds as exclusives. I think that is perfectly valid. Now, before I get flamed with 'Hasbro was never gonna make these!', observe.
Last year at botcon, Hasbro said they might start Alternators up again after the movie. So there was a chance it would be continued. Right now, at tfw2005, Kickback, who has Hasbro sources, is flat out saying it's done, no chance. So, things changed over the course of a year. What once was possible, is now apparently not. Why couldn't the opposite happen? That's what galls me about people claiming it never would've happened. It's too soon to say that! Had Hasbro not given the go-ahead for these exclusives, there is no reason why somewhere down the road they couldn't have slipped Thrust into a later line. The RiD car bros. mold got reused. Armada bendy Prime. BM Blackarachnia. Whichever series had that hideous Sideswipe. There's no reason it couldn't have been done. Of course, now it can't. Maybe they'll release a Thrust mold at some point with a different paint scheme, so I can repaint it. I'll be doing that already with a Ramjet, but it would be nice to get the remolded wings.

I agree with MagnusPrimal 100% on this one. Without Botcon, Hasbro would have released Thundercracker at the very least, if not in a new Classics assortment, then in another line. It may have taken two to three years, but he'd have seen the light of day. Hasbro loves repaints; all the Seekers would have made great filler for any line down the road.
I understand the decision to use the big names to get the publicity for the Botcon set, but if they had put the generic yellow, green and purple seekers in the set, wouldn't the Botcon collectors have been just as happy? Did they have to use iconic show characters? They made the decision, it's worked out for them (obviously) so this now gives them carte blanche to hijack any line and pull out any repaints that would give us G1 updates. I think it sets a bad precedent. From here on out, whenever a new mold gets previewed and the fandom goes 'Hey, that would make a great (insert G1 name)' there is much higher percentage that the repaint ends up a Botcon exclusive, rather than a retail release.
And as far as fans getting to 'score', I'd be willing to put money that a hefty number of those last 100-200 sets aren't going to fans at all, but went to any toy vendor in the country that could afford to sign up his mom, his brother, and his dog for Primus packages. This set was speculative gold from the announcement. Now, it's guaranteed.
Unless, of course, Botcon applies their 'will never be released in stores' clause literally, and represses the set to sell on the site directly...
